Abstract
本发明提供一种侧面式固定更换镶件装置,所述侧面式固定更换镶件装置包括镶件(1)以及与所述镶件(1)相配合的固定更换件(2),所述镶件(1)包括镶件主体(3),所述镶件主体(3)设有固定孔(4)和第一斜切面(5),且所述第一斜切面(5)设置在远离型芯卡固端的端面上;所述固定更换件(2)包括与所述固定孔(4)相匹配的固定更换件主体(6),所述固定更换件主体(6)的一端端面设有固定螺丝孔(6),另一端端面设有与所述第一斜切面(5)相匹配的第二斜切面(8)。本发明提供的侧面式固定更换镶件装置的操作过程简单,耗时短、效率高,可以解决现有技术中更换镶件的方式导致生产效率低,产品质量差的问题。
This invention provides a side-mounted fixing and replacing insert device, comprising an insert (1) and a fixing and replacing component (2) that cooperates with the insert (1). The insert (1) includes an insert body (3), which has a fixing hole (4) and a first oblique surface (5), with the first oblique surface (5) located on the end face away from the core locking end. The fixing and replacing component (2) includes a fixing and replacing component body (6) that matches the fixing hole (4). One end face of the fixing and replacing component body (6) has a fixing screw hole (6), and the other end face has a second oblique surface (8) that matches the first oblique surface (5). The side-mounted fixing and replacing insert device provided by this invention has a simple operation process, short operation time, and high efficiency, which can solve the problems of low production efficiency and poor product quality caused by the existing insert replacement method.

背景技术Background technique
随着人们对橡胶、塑料产品需求量的增大,注塑产业也随之快速发展起来。注塑成型指的是一种对工业产品生产造型的方法,具体指将受热融化的材料由高压射入模腔,经冷却固化后得到成形品的方法,注塑成型工艺可通过注射成型机和注塑模具相配合来实现,其产品通常分为橡胶注塑产品和塑料注塑产品两大类。注射成型机(简称注射机或注塑机)是注塑工艺中的重要设备,注塑机利用塑料成型模具将热塑性塑料或热固性塑料制成各种形状的塑料制品。注塑模具指的是一种生产塑胶制品的工具,也是赋予塑胶制品完整结构和精确尺寸的工具。注塑模具由于塑料的品种、性能,塑料制品的形状、结构以及注射机的类型等不同而千变万化,因此,在生产不同类型的塑胶产品时,往往需要更换不同的注塑模具。在注塑模具中的中心部位固定有型芯,型芯是用于模具运作的精密零件,型芯材料选择的好坏直接关系到模具的使用寿命和模具的价格。With the increase of people's demand for rubber and plastic products, the injection molding industry has also developed rapidly. Injection molding refers to a method of producing and modeling industrial products. Specifically, it refers to the method of injecting heated and melted materials into the mold cavity by high pressure, and obtaining molded products after cooling and solidification. The injection molding process can be achieved through injection molding machines and injection molds. Its products are usually divided into two categories: rubber injection molding products and plastic injection molding products. Injection molding machine (referred to as injection machine or injection molding machine) is an important equipment in the injection molding process. The injection molding machine uses plastic molding molds to make thermoplastics or thermosetting plastics into plastic products of various shapes. Injection mold refers to a tool for producing plastic products, and it is also a tool for giving plastic products a complete structure and precise dimensions. Injection molds are ever-changing due to the variety and performance of plastics, the shape and structure of plastic products, and the types of injection machines. Therefore, when producing different types of plastic products, it is often necessary to replace different injection molds. There is a core fixed in the center of the injection mold. The core is a precision part used for the operation of the mold. The choice of core material is directly related to the service life of the mold and the price of the mold.
近些年,为了节约产品的制造成本,塑胶企业通常会采用一种注塑模具生产多种产品的方式加工塑胶产品,其实现方式是更换注塑模具内部的型芯。当待生产的产品为较为相近的系列产品时,常常在模具型芯上镶嵌镶件,通过更换镶件来改变型芯。一般的,镶件的一端卡固在型芯的凹槽内,但是,当注塑机工作时,镶件因冲击、晃动等因素极易出现松动、脱落的现象,因此,需要在镶件上部卡固型芯凹槽的基础上,借助其他方式将镶件牢固的固定在型芯上,以保证镶件卡固的稳定性,进而确保注塑机的正常运行。目前,传统的固定方式为采用螺丝固定安装镶件,当需要改变生产产品时,需从注塑机上拆下注塑模具,取出型芯、拆卸螺丝进而更换镶件;然后将新的镶件重新卡固在型芯上,并通过螺丝将新的镶件固定安装于型芯上,再将更换好镶件的型芯安装入注塑模具内,进一步将注塑模具安装到注塑机内,继续生产下一种类型的待生产产品。In recent years, in order to save the manufacturing cost of products, plastic companies usually use one injection mold to produce multiple products to process plastic products. The way to achieve this is to replace the core inside the injection mold. When the product to be produced is a relatively similar series of products, inserts are often embedded on the mold core, and the core is changed by replacing the insert. Generally, one end of the insert is clamped in the groove of the core. However, when the injection molding machine is working, the insert is prone to loosening and falling off due to factors such as impact and shaking. Therefore, it is necessary to clamp the upper part of the insert. On the basis of fixing the groove of the core, the insert is firmly fixed on the core by other means to ensure the stability of the insert clamping, thereby ensuring the normal operation of the injection molding machine. At present, the traditional fixing method is to use screws to fix and install the inserts. When the production product needs to be changed, the injection mold needs to be removed from the injection molding machine, the core should be taken out, the screws should be removed, and then the inserts should be replaced; then the new inserts should be clamped again Fix it on the core, and fix the new insert on the core with screws, then install the core with the replaced insert into the injection mold, and further install the injection mold into the injection molding machine to continue to produce the next types of products to be produced.
由上述更换镶件的过程可知,现有技术中,固定镶件的方式使得更换镶件的过程耗时较长,一般需要2个小时以上,影响正常生产流程,大大降低生产效率。同时,由于停机的时间较长,影响注塑机连续生产的稳定性,导致更换镶件后出现大量不合格产品,降低产品质量。It can be seen from the above process of replacing inserts that in the prior art, the way of fixing inserts makes the process of replacing inserts take a long time, usually more than 2 hours, which affects the normal production process and greatly reduces production efficiency. At the same time, due to the long shutdown time, the stability of the continuous production of the injection molding machine is affected, resulting in a large number of substandard products after the replacement of inserts, which reduces product quality.

请参照图1,所示为本发明实施例提供的第一种侧面式固定更换镶件装置的结构示意图。Please refer to FIG. 1 , which is a schematic structural view of the first side-mounted insert replacement device provided by an embodiment of the present invention.
如图1所示,本发明提供一种侧面式固定更换镶件装置,所述侧面式固定更换镶件装置包括镶件1以及与所述镶件1相配合的固定更换件2,所述镶件1包括镶件主体3,所述镶件主体3设有固定孔4和第一斜切面5,且所述第一斜切面5设置在远离型芯卡固端的端面上;所述固定更换件2包括与所述固定孔4相匹配的固定更换件主体6,所述固定更换件主体6的一端端面设有固定螺丝孔7,另一端端面设有与所述第一斜切面5相匹配的第二斜切面8。As shown in Figure 1, the present invention provides a side-type fixed replacement insert device, the side fixed replacement insert device includes an insert 1 and a fixed replacement part 2 matched with the insert 1, the insert The piece 1 includes an insert body 3, the insert body 3 is provided with a fixing hole 4 and a first chamfered surface 5, and the first chamfered surface 5 is arranged on the end surface away from the clamping end of the core; the fixed replacement part 2 includes a fixed replacement body 6 matching the fixing hole 4, one end surface of the fixed replacement body 6 is provided with a fixing screw hole 7, and the other end surface is provided with a matching first chamfered surface 5 Second bevel 8.
请参照图2,所示为本发明实施例提供的一种侧面式固定更换镶件装置固定镶件的示意图。Please refer to FIG. 2 , which is a schematic diagram of a side-mounted insert replacement device for fixing inserts provided by an embodiment of the present invention.
由图2可知,本发明提供的侧面式固定更换镶件装置利用设置在镶件1上的固定孔4与设置在固定更换件2上的第二斜切面8相互配合来固定镶件1。具体的固定镶件过程为:将固定更换件2从镶件1的侧面插入设置于镶件主体3上的固定孔4中,固定更换件2上的第二斜切面8与固定孔4结合紧密后,将固定更换件2通过固定螺丝孔7固定在注塑模具上,以防止固定更换件2出现松动、滑动以及脱落的现象,影响镶件1的固定。由于镶件1同时受到上部型芯的卡固作用和固定更换件2的固定作用两方面的作用力,因此,确保镶件1牢固的固定在型芯上。As can be seen from FIG. 2 , the side-mounted insert replacement device provided by the present invention utilizes the fixing hole 4 provided on the insert 1 to cooperate with the second chamfered surface 8 provided on the fixed replacement part 2 to fix the insert 1 . The specific process of fixing the insert is: insert the fixed replacement part 2 from the side of the insert 1 into the fixing hole 4 provided on the main body 3 of the insert, and the second chamfered surface 8 on the fixed replacement part 2 is closely combined with the fixing hole 4 Finally, the fixed replacement part 2 is fixed on the injection mold through the fixing screw hole 7, so as to prevent the fixed replacement part 2 from loosening, sliding and falling off, which will affect the fixing of the insert 1. Since the insert 1 is simultaneously subjected to two forces: the clamping action of the upper core and the fixing action of the fixed replacement part 2 , it is ensured that the insert 1 is firmly fixed on the core.
请参照图3,所示为本发明实施例提供的一种侧面式固定更换镶件装置更换镶件的示意图。Please refer to FIG. 3 , which is a schematic diagram of insert replacement of a side-mounted fixed insert replacement device provided by an embodiment of the present invention.
由图3可知,本发明提供的侧面式固定更换镶件装置利用设置在镶件1上的第一斜切面5与设置在固定更换件2上的第二斜切面8相互配合来更换镶件1。具体的更换镶件过程为:当一种产品生产完毕需要更换镶件1时,将固定更换件2从固定孔4中取出,翻转180°后,将固定更换件2再次从侧面插入型芯中,此时,第二斜切面8与第一斜切面5接触并且相互配合,由于镶件1受到固定更换件2斜向上的作用力,因此,镶件从型芯上方被顶出。将顶出的镶件1取出后更换为待生产产品的镶件即可完成镶件的更换操作。It can be seen from Fig. 3 that the side-type fixed replacement insert device provided by the present invention uses the first beveled surface 5 provided on the insert 1 to cooperate with the second beveled surface 8 provided on the fixed replacement part 2 to replace the insert 1 . The specific insert replacement process is as follows: when a product needs to be replaced after the production of a product, take out the fixed replacement part 2 from the fixed hole 4, turn it over 180°, insert the fixed replacement part 2 into the core again from the side , at this time, the second chamfered surface 8 is in contact with the first chamfered surface 5 and cooperates with each other. Since the insert 1 is subjected to an oblique upward force from the fixed replacement part 2, the insert is pushed out from above the core. The replacement operation of the insert can be completed by taking out the ejected insert 1 and replacing it with the insert of the product to be produced.
由以上所示的镶件1的固定更换过程可知,本发明提供的侧面式固定更换镶件装置的操作过程简单,耗时短、效率高,利用固定更换件2与镶件1的配合作用即可完成镶件1的固定和更换,不需要拆卸注塑模具,也不需要拆卸型芯,大大节约更换时间,提高生产效率和质量。It can be seen from the fixed replacement process of the insert 1 shown above that the operation process of the side-type fixed replacement insert device provided by the present invention is simple, time-consuming, and high in efficiency. The fixing and replacement of the insert 1 can be completed without dismantling the injection mold or the core, which greatly saves replacement time and improves production efficiency and quality.
请参照图4,所示为本发明实施例提供的第一种镶件结构示意图。Please refer to FIG. 4 , which is a schematic diagram of the structure of the first insert provided by the embodiment of the present invention.
由图4可知,固定孔4为横向贯穿镶件主体3的通孔。当固定更换件2从侧面插入镶件1时,固定更换件2上的第二斜切面8可以贯穿固定孔4,甚至可以将第二斜切面8的前端伸出固定孔4,从而达到更好的固定效果。当然,固定孔4也可以为不贯穿镶件主体3的固定孔,请参照图5,所示为本发明实施例提供的第二种镶件结构示意图。由图5可知,固定孔4不贯穿镶件主体3,当镶件1需要固定时,将固定更换件2插入固定孔4内部即可。It can be seen from FIG. 4 that the fixing hole 4 is a through hole penetrating through the main body 3 of the insert in the transverse direction. When the fixed replacement part 2 is inserted into the insert 1 from the side, the second beveled surface 8 on the fixed replacement part 2 can pass through the fixing hole 4, and even the front end of the second beveled surface 8 can extend out of the fixed hole 4, so as to achieve better the fixed effect. Of course, the fixing hole 4 can also be a fixing hole that does not penetrate the main body 3 of the insert. Please refer to FIG. 5 , which is a schematic diagram of the structure of the second insert provided by the embodiment of the present invention. It can be seen from FIG. 5 that the fixing hole 4 does not penetrate the main body 3 of the insert. When the insert 1 needs to be fixed, the fixing replacement part 2 can be inserted into the fixing hole 4 .
本实施例提供的固定孔4的内表面可以为平整平面,也可以为螺纹面或者其他形式的内表面。其中,平整平面可以为水平面,也可以为斜切面。请参考图4和图5,由图4和图5可知,固定孔4的内表面为与第二斜切面8相匹配的第三斜切面9,且第三斜切面9的倾斜方向与第一斜切面5的倾斜方向相反。当需要更换镶件1时,将固定更换件2从固定孔4中取出,翻转180°后,将固定更换件2再次从侧面插入型芯中,此时,固定更换件2上的第二斜切面8与第一斜切面5接触并且相互配合,将镶件从型芯上方顶出。本实施例中,固定孔4的上表面与镶件1最下端端面的距离应大于或者等于固定更换件2的宽度,以便固定更换件2可以顺利更换镶件1。The inner surface of the fixing hole 4 provided in this embodiment may be a flat plane, or may be a threaded surface or an inner surface of other forms. Wherein, the flat plane may be a horizontal plane or an inclined plane. Please refer to Fig. 4 and Fig. 5, as can be seen from Fig. 4 and Fig. 5, the inner surface of the fixing hole 4 is a third chamfered surface 9 matched with the second chamfered surface 8, and the inclination direction of the third chamfered surface 9 is the same as that of the first chamfered surface 9. The direction of inclination of the chamfered surface 5 is opposite. When the insert 1 needs to be replaced, the fixed replacement part 2 is taken out from the fixing hole 4, and after turning over 180°, the fixed replacement part 2 is inserted into the core from the side again. The cutting surface 8 is in contact with the first chamfering surface 5 and cooperates with each other to push the insert out from above the core. In this embodiment, the distance between the upper surface of the fixing hole 4 and the lowermost end surface of the insert 1 should be greater than or equal to the width of the fixed replacement part 2, so that the fixed replacement part 2 can replace the insert 1 smoothly.
请参照图6,所示为本发明实施例提供的第三种镶件结构示意图。Please refer to FIG. 6 , which is a schematic structural diagram of a third insert provided by an embodiment of the present invention.
由图6可知,第三斜切面9的倾斜方向与第一斜切面5的倾斜方向相同。本实施例中,固定孔4的上表面与镶件1最下端端面的距离应大于固定更换件2的宽度,在镶件1需要固定时,固定更换件2需通过固定螺丝孔7的固定,以防止固定更换件2摇晃、脱落,从而保证镶件1可以牢固的固定在型芯上。由于本实施例中第三斜切面9的倾斜方向与第一斜切面5的倾斜方向相同,因此,在更换镶件1时不需要将固定更换件2翻转180°,直接利用第二斜切面8将镶件1顶出。It can be seen from FIG. 6 that the inclination direction of the third beveled surface 9 is the same as the inclination direction of the first beveled surface 5 . In this embodiment, the distance between the upper surface of the fixing hole 4 and the lowermost end surface of the insert 1 should be greater than the width of the fixed replacement part 2. When the insert 1 needs to be fixed, the fixed replacement part 2 needs to be fixed through the fixing screw hole 7. To prevent the fixed replacement part 2 from shaking and falling off, so as to ensure that the insert 1 can be firmly fixed on the core. Since the inclination direction of the third beveled surface 9 in this embodiment is the same as the inclination direction of the first beveled surface 5, it is not necessary to turn the fixed replacement part 2 over 180° when replacing the insert 1, and directly use the second beveled surface 8 Push insert 1 out.
请参照图7和图8,所示分别为本发明实施例提供的第四种镶件结构示意图和本发明实施例提供的第二种侧面式固定更换镶件装置固定镶件的示意图。Please refer to FIG. 7 and FIG. 8 , which are respectively a schematic diagram of the structure of the fourth type of insert provided by the embodiment of the present invention and a schematic diagram of the fixed insert of the second type of side-type fixed replacement insert device provided by the embodiment of the present invention.
由图7和图8可知,固定孔4的内表面为平整平面且为水平面,当需要固定镶件1时,将固定更换件2从侧面插入镶件1的固定孔4内。本实施例中,固定孔4的高度应稍大于固定更换件2的高度,以保证固定更换件2可以顺利的插入固定孔4内,并牢固固定镶件1。固定孔4的上表面与镶件最下端端面的距离应大于固定更换件2的宽度,因此,固定更换件2需通过固定螺丝孔7固定,以防止固定更换件2摇晃、脱落。镶件1的更换过程与上实施例类似,这里不再赘述。需要说明的是,在固定镶件1的过程中,由于第二斜切面8可以伸出固定孔4,因此,第二斜切面8的倾斜方向并不限于图8所示的倾斜方向,也就是说,在镶件1需要固定时,可以将固定更换件2按照第二斜切面8的倾斜方向与第一斜切面5的倾斜方向相同的方向插入镶件1,也可以将固定更换件2按照第二斜切面8的倾斜方向与第一斜切面5的倾斜方向相反的方向插入镶件1。当第二斜切面8的倾斜方向与第一斜切面5的倾斜方向相同时,更换镶件1则不需要翻转180°,直接利用第二斜切面8将镶件1顶出。It can be seen from Fig. 7 and Fig. 8 that the inner surface of the fixing hole 4 is flat and horizontal. When the insert 1 needs to be fixed, the fixing replacement part 2 is inserted into the fixing hole 4 of the insert 1 from the side. In this embodiment, the height of the fixing hole 4 should be slightly greater than that of the fixing replacement part 2, so as to ensure that the fixing replacement part 2 can be smoothly inserted into the fixing hole 4 and the insert 1 can be firmly fixed. The distance between the upper surface of the fixing hole 4 and the lowermost end face of the insert should be greater than the width of the fixed replacement part 2. Therefore, the fixed replacement part 2 needs to be fixed through the fixing screw hole 7 to prevent the fixed replacement part 2 from shaking and falling off. The replacement process of the insert 1 is similar to that of the above embodiment, and will not be repeated here. It should be noted that, in the process of fixing the insert 1, since the second beveled surface 8 can protrude from the fixing hole 4, the inclination direction of the second beveled surface 8 is not limited to the inclination direction shown in FIG. 8 , that is, That is to say, when the insert 1 needs to be fixed, the fixed replacement part 2 can be inserted into the insert 1 in the same direction as the inclination direction of the second beveled surface 8 and the inclination direction of the first beveled surface 5, or the fixed replacement part 2 can be inserted according to The inclination direction of the second beveled surface 8 is inserted into the insert 1 in a direction opposite to the inclination direction of the first beveled surface 5 . When the inclination direction of the second beveled surface 8 is the same as the inclination direction of the first beveled surface 5, the insert 1 does not need to be turned over 180° for replacement, and the second beveled surface 8 is directly used to push the insert 1 out.
本实施例中,第二斜切面8的倾斜角度与所述第一斜切面5的倾斜角度相一致,且均为20-60度。优选的,第二斜切面8和第一斜切面5的倾斜角度均为30度。第三斜切面9的倾斜角度可以与第二斜切面8相同,也可以不相同,只要保证第二斜切面8可以顺利插入固定孔4中即可。In this embodiment, the inclination angle of the second beveled surface 8 is consistent with the inclination angle of the first beveled surface 5, and both are 20-60 degrees. Preferably, the inclination angles of the second beveled surface 8 and the first beveled surface 5 are both 30 degrees. The inclination angle of the third beveled surface 9 can be the same as that of the second beveled surface 8 or not, as long as the second beveled surface 8 can be smoothly inserted into the fixing hole 4 .
第二斜切面8的倾斜角度与第三斜切面9的倾斜角度相一致,且均为20-60度。优选的,第二斜切面8和第三斜切面9的倾斜角度均为30度。第一斜切面5的倾斜角度可以与第二斜切面8相同,也可以不相同,只要保证第二斜切面8可以顺利的将镶件1顶出中即可。The inclination angle of the second beveled surface 8 is consistent with the inclination angle of the third beveled surface 9, and both are 20-60 degrees. Preferably, the inclination angles of the second beveled surface 8 and the third beveled surface 9 are both 30 degrees. The inclination angle of the first beveled surface 5 can be the same as that of the second beveled surface 8 or not, as long as the second beveled surface 8 can smoothly push out the insert 1 .
优选的,第一斜切面5、第二斜切面8和第三斜切面9的倾斜角度均相同,且第一斜切面5、第二斜切面8和第三斜切面9的倾斜角度均为20-60度。当第一斜切面5、第二斜切面8和第三斜切面9的倾斜角度均相同时,使得镶件1的固定和更换更为顺利,作用于固定更换件2的推力较小即可完成镶件1的固定和更换。更为优选的,第一斜切面5、第二斜切面8和第三斜切面9的倾斜角度均为30度。Preferably, the inclination angles of the first beveled surface 5, the second beveled surface 8 and the third beveled surface 9 are all the same, and the inclination angles of the first beveled surface 5, the second beveled surface 8 and the third beveled surface 9 are all 20 -60 degrees. When the inclination angles of the first beveled surface 5, the second beveled surface 8, and the third beveled surface 9 are all the same, the fixation and replacement of the insert 1 is smoother, and the thrust acting on the fixed replacement part 2 is relatively small. Fixing and replacement of insert 1. More preferably, the inclination angles of the first beveled surface 5 , the second beveled surface 8 and the third beveled surface 9 are all 30 degrees.
请参照图9和图10,所示分别为本发明实施例提供的第一种固定更换件的结构示意图和本发明实施例提供的第二种固定更换件的结构示意图。由图9所示,固定更换件2的前端面与上端面相接,即第二斜切面8为与固定更换件2上端面相接的倾斜面。由图10所示,第二斜切面8为楔形面。当固定孔4的内表面为具有第三斜切面9的倾斜面时,楔形面有利于第二斜切面8与固定孔4相互配合,确保固定更换件2可以更加牢固的固定镶件1。Please refer to FIG. 9 and FIG. 10 , which are respectively a schematic structural view of a first type of fixed replacement part provided by an embodiment of the present invention and a structural schematic diagram of a second type of fixed replacement part provided by an embodiment of the present invention. As shown in FIG. 9 , the front end surface of the fixed replacement part 2 is in contact with the upper end surface, that is, the second beveled surface 8 is an inclined surface connected with the upper end surface of the fixed replacement part 2 . As shown in FIG. 10 , the second chamfered surface 8 is a wedge-shaped surface. When the inner surface of the fixing hole 4 is an inclined surface with the third beveled surface 9 , the wedge-shaped surface is conducive to the cooperation between the second beveled surface 8 and the fixing hole 4 to ensure that the fixed replacement part 2 can fix the insert 1 more firmly.
请参照图11,所示为本发明实施例提供的第二种侧面式固定更换镶件装置的结构示意图。Please refer to FIG. 11 , which is a schematic structural diagram of a second side-mounted insert replacement device provided by an embodiment of the present invention.
由图11可知,本实施例中提供的侧面式固定更换镶件装置还包括拉拔器10,所述拉拔器10与所述固定更换件2可拆卸连接。当需要更换镶件1时,利用拉拔器10的拉拔作用力将固定更换件2从固定孔4内取出,再进行更换操作。本实施例中,固定更换件2和拉拔器10的连接方式为螺钉连接,当然,也可以为卡固连接等其他可以实现连接的方式。As can be seen from FIG. 11 , the side-mounted fixed replacement insert device provided in this embodiment further includes a puller 10 that is detachably connected to the fixed replacement part 2 . When the insert 1 needs to be replaced, the fixed replacement part 2 is taken out from the fixed hole 4 by the pulling force of the puller 10, and then the replacement operation is performed. In this embodiment, the connection between the fixed replacement part 2 and the puller 10 is a screw connection, of course, other possible connection methods such as clamp connection can also be used.
具体的,请参照图12和图13,所示分别为本发明实施例提供的第三种固定更换件的结构示意图和本发明实施例提供的拉拔器的结构示意图。由图12和图13可知,固定更换件2上与固定螺丝孔7相同的一端端面上设置有拉拔螺丝孔11,拉拔器10的前端设置有与所述拉拔螺丝孔11相对应的拉拔螺丝12。当需要更换镶件1时,利用拉拔器10将固定更换件2从固定孔4内取出,具体的,将设置于拉拔器10前端的拉拔螺丝12拧入固定更换件2上的拉拔螺丝孔11中,从而实现拉拔器10与固定更换件2的可拆卸连接。当固定好拉拔器10后,对拉拔器10施加向外的作用力,从而将与拉拔器10相连接的固定更换件2拔出。需要说明的是,所述向外的作用力为与拉拔螺丝12拧入拉拔螺丝孔11的方向相反方向的作用力。Specifically, please refer to FIG. 12 and FIG. 13 , which are respectively a schematic structural view of a third type of fixed replacement provided by an embodiment of the present invention and a schematic structural view of a puller provided by an embodiment of the present invention. It can be seen from Fig. 12 and Fig. 13 that a pulling screw hole 11 is provided on the end face of the fixing replacement part 2 that is the same as the fixing screw hole 7, and the front end of the puller 10 is provided with a corresponding to the pulling screw hole 11. Pull out screw 12. When the insert 1 needs to be replaced, the fixed replacement part 2 is taken out from the fixed hole 4 by using the puller 10. Specifically, the pull screw 12 arranged at the front end of the puller 10 is screwed into the pull screw 12 on the fixed replacement part 2. Pull out the screw hole 11, so as to realize the detachable connection between the puller 10 and the fixed replacement part 2. After the puller 10 is fixed, an outward force is applied to the puller 10 to pull out the fixed replacement part 2 connected to the puller 10 . It should be noted that the outward acting force is an acting force in a direction opposite to the direction in which the pulling screw 12 is screwed into the pulling screw hole 11 .
